在 Linux 下安装 Nginx 我们既可以使用源码的方式编译安装,也可以直接使用 yum 的方式来进行安装。
我们打开如下网址,打开 Nginx 的官网,网址如下:
http://nginx.org/en/download.html
此时页面如下:
其中,Nginx 的版本介绍如下:
版本 | 描述 |
---|---|
Mainline version | 开发版 |
Stable version | 稳定版 |
Legacy versions | 历史版本 |
Source Code | 源代码 |
Pre-Built Packages | 编译好的安装包 |
我们使用 yum 安装 nginx 的时候,需要找到官网下面的 Pre-Built Packages,具体页面如下:
我们点击上面标红的连接,进入到新的页面,此时,如下图所示:
我们在本页面搜索 Centos,找到 Centos 安装的方式,如下图所示:
我们只需要拷贝上面的 stable 的 yum 源即可,即,如下代码:
[nginx-stable]
name=nginx stable repo
baseurl=http://nginx.org/packages/centos/$releasever/$basearch/
gpgcheck=1
enabled=1
gpgkey=https://nginx.org/keys/nginx_signing.key
module_hotfixes=true
此时,我们使用 vim 新建一个 yum 源,具体命令如下:
vim /etc/yum.repos.d/nginx.repo
如下图所示:
此时,我们将刚才拷贝的 yum 源配置粘贴进来,并且,将版本修改为我们当前的版本,即 7,如下图所示:
具体代码如下:
[nginx]
name=nginx stable repo
baseurl=http://nginx.org/packages/centos/7/$basearch/
gpgcheck=1
enabled=1
gpgkey=https://nginx.org/keys/nginx_signing.key
module_hotfixes=true
此时,保存并退出,我们使用 yum 查看当前可以使用的 nginx 版本,具体命令如下:
yum list | grep nginx
此时,输出如下:
现在,我们输入以下命令,开始安装 nginx:
yum install nginx -y
安装完毕后,如下图所示:
此时,我们就通过 yum 安装好了 nginx。
Nginx 安装完毕后,我们通过 nginx 命令,可以查看当前安装的 nginx 版本,具体命令如下:
nginx -v
此时,输出如下:
同时,我们还可以通过 nginx 命令查看编译的参数,具体命令如下:
nginx -V
此时,输出如下:
我们看到了所有的 nginx 的编译参数。